Verbal intelligence is the ability to understand and reason using concepts framed in words. More broadly, it is linked to problem solving, abstract reasoning, and working memory. Verbal intelligence is one of the most g-loaded abilities. See more In order to understand linguistic intelligence, it is important to understand the mechanisms that control speech and language.
